What Features Should a Trail Running Shoe Have for Optimal Ankle Support?

Trail running shoes should have features tailored for optimal ankle support, such as high-cut designs, cushioning, and stabilization technologies.

  1. High-cut design
  2. Ankle cushioning
  3. Heel counter support
  4. Torsional rigidity
  5. Adjustable laces or straps
  6. Flexible midsole
  7. Traction outsole
  8. Weight distribution

The features for optimal ankle support vary depending on personal preferences and running conditions.

  1. High-cut design:
    High-cut designs enhance ankle support by covering the ankle joint. This added height helps prevent rolling and offers stability on uneven terrain. Studies show that shoes with higher collars reduce the risk of sprains significantly when traversing rugged trails.

  2. Ankle cushioning:
    Ankle cushioning refers to padding around the collar and tongue of the shoe. This cushioning absorbs shock and reduces impact on the ankle during runs. A comfortable padded collar prevents chafing while offering additional support. Research indicates that models with enhanced cushioning lead to greater runner satisfaction and performance.

  3. Heel counter support:
    Heel counter support involves rigid material surrounding the heel section of the shoe. It prevents excessive movement of the heel, enhancing stability. A well-structured heel counter can decrease the likelihood of injuries by anchoring the foot more securely within the shoe.

  4. Torsional rigidity:
    Torsional rigidity is the shoe’s resistance to twisting from heel to toe. A shoe with better torsional stiffness offers superior support while maintaining flexibility. This characteristic allows for natural foot movement without sacrificing balance, particularly on rough trails.

  5. Adjustable laces or straps:
    Adjustable laces or straps facilitate a customized fit. They allow runners to modify tightness around the ankle to their preference. A secure fit decreases the risk of blisters and ensures the shoe performs well over varied terrains.

  6. Flexible midsole:
    A flexible midsole provides shock absorption and enhances comfort while allowing natural foot movement. For trail runners, the midsole should support foot motion, especially when navigating turns and obstacles on the trail.

  7. Traction outsole:
    A traction outsole features a pattern designed to grip various surfaces, providing stability during descents and ascents. High-quality outsoles guard against slips while maintaining ankle support by encouraging confident footing on steep or uneven ground.

  8. Weight distribution:
    Weight distribution in a shoe relates to how mass is distributed across the foot. A well-balanced shoe helps maintain stability and minimizes the chance of ankle injuries. Runners may prefer different configurations, as some may prioritize a lightweight feel, whereas others require a sturdier construction for challenging terrain.

How Does Ankle Support Impact Your Stability While Trail Running?

Ankle support impacts your stability while trail running by providing additional control and reducing the risk of injuries. Strong ankle support helps maintain proper alignment of the foot and lower leg. This support prevents excessive rolling or twisting of the ankle, which can lead to sprains.

When your ankles are stabilized, you can efficiently navigate uneven terrain, rocks, and roots. This stability enhances your confidence while running on trails. Moreover, good ankle support can improve overall balance. When your ankles are secure, you can focus more on your stride and less on potential falls.

Additionally, ankle support aids in muscle activation. With stability in the ankle joint, other muscles can engage effectively, reducing fatigue during long runs. This interconnectedness contributes to a smoother running experience on challenging surfaces.

In summary, ankle support provides crucial stability, reduces injury risk, enhances balance, and boosts muscle efficiency while trail running.

How Can You Select the Best Ankle Support Trail Running Shoe for Your Unique Needs?

To select the best ankle support trail running shoe for your unique needs, consider fit, support level, terrain type, cushioning, and weight.

Fit: The shoe should fit snugly but not tightly. It must allow for toe movement without discomfort. A well-fitted shoe prevents blisters and provides stability during runs. Measure your foot size accurately. Remember that foot dimensions can change over time, so try on shoes later in the day when your feet are slightly swollen.

Support Level: Ankle support can vary significantly across models. Shoes with higher collars provide added support and are beneficial for runners prone to ankle injuries. Look for models with additional reinforcement around the ankle area. A study by Backes et al. (2018) indicated that increased ankle support reduces sprain risk.

Terrain Type: Different trail types require different shoes. For rocky terrains, select shoes with sturdy outsoles to prevent punctures. For muddy trails, choose shoes with aggressive traction. Understanding your running environment helps in selecting the right shoe.

Cushioning: Cushioning affects comfort and injury prevention. A well-cushioned shoe absorbs impact and reduces stress on joints. Consider your weight and running style; heavier runners benefit from greater cushioning. Research by Dempsey et al. (2020) suggests that adequate cushioning can lower the risk of stress fractures.

Weight: Lighter shoes facilitate quicker movements but may offer less support. If your focus is on speed, consider lighter options. Balance is key; find a shoe that provides adequate protection without excessive weight. According to Thornton (2021), optimal shoe weight improves performance without compromising safety.

Choosing the right ankle support trail running shoe involves matching these factors to your unique needs and preferences. Test multiple options and consult product reviews for further insights.
